All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Abbots Road South area has the 23rd highest crime rate of 97 local areas in Humberstone & Hamilton , and the 335th highest crime rate of 954 local areas in Leicester .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Abbots Road South (LE5 1DA) in the last 12 months was 118.9 per 1,000 residents and was 33.1% higher than the Humberstone & Hamilton average (89.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 16 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 500.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Drugs 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 24 (≈ 58.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 128.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Abbots Road South (LE5 1DA), the main crime hotspot is near Moat Court. Police recorded 127 crimes here, including 48 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
